Output 753907f8629269ef663a5488ec7dc79172d0b24b85c4ca18c5c4dd437b91f25d:24

value
23238593
script pubkey
OP_0 OP_PUSHBYTES_20 731cd36a3be7ba1087a7672563089f5614c89df1
address
ltc1qwvwdx63mu7apppa8vujkxzyl2c2v38036madv4
transaction
753907f8629269ef663a5488ec7dc79172d0b24b85c4ca18c5c4dd437b91f25d
spent
true